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 50 minutes | Total Time: 1 hour 5 minutes | Yield: 6-8 servings | Category: Dinner, Main Course, Casserole | Method: Baking, Sautéing | Cuisine: American | Diet: N/A
Essential Ingredients for Creamy Chicken and Rice Bake
This classic comfort food casserole comes together with a handful of simple and affordable pantry staples.
- Chicken: 1.5 lbs (about 700g) bo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
- Rice: 1 ½ cups uncooked long-grain white rice
- Aromatics: 1 large onion, chopped
- For the Creamy Sauce:
- 4 tablespoons butter
- ¼ cup all-purpose flour
- 2 cups milk
- 2 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- Cheese: 1 ½ c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
- Seasoning: 1 teaspoon garlic powder, 1 teaspoon salt, ½ teaspoon black pepper
Ingredients Notes
A little more detail on our key ingredients will ensure your casserole is perfectly creamy and delicious.
- The Chicken: For this recipe, we use boneless, skinless chicken breasts cut into uniform, bite-sized cubes. This ensures the chicken cooks perfectly and stays tender within the casserole. Taking the extra minute to quickly brown the chicken pieces before baking adds a huge layer of deep, savory flavour.
- The Rice: This recipe is specifically designed to use uncooked long-grain white rice, which will cook to a perfect, fluffy tenderness right in the creamy sauce as the casserole bakes. It is very important not to use an instant or quick-cook rice, as it will turn to mush in the liquid.
- The Creamy Sauce: Our simple, from-scratch cream sauce is what makes this casserole so much better than versions that use canned soup. The “roux,” which is the paste made from cooking the melted butter and flour together, is a classic thickening agent that creates a beautifully stable and velvety sauce.
- The Cheese: A good, sharp cheddar cheese provides the best, boldest, and most classic cheesy flavour for this comfort food dish. For the creamiest, most even melt, it is always best to buy a block of cheddar cheese and shred it yourself just before using.
How to Make Creamy Chicken and Rice Bake
Let’s walk through the simple steps to create this delicious and comforting one-dish meal.
- Step 1: Prepare the Oven and Sauté the Onion. First, preheat your oven to 190°C (375°F). In a large pot or Dutch oven,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ook for 4-5 minutes, until it has softened.
- Step 2: Create the Roux and Creamy Sauce. Sprinkle the flour over the softened onions and stir for one minute to cook out the raw flour taste. While whisking constantly, slowly pour in the chicken broth and then the milk. Continue to whisk until the mixture is smooth, bring it to a gentle simmer, and cook for about 5 minutes until it has thickened.
- Step 3: Add the Final Ingredients. Remove the pot from the heat. Stir in 1 cup of the shredded cheddar cheese, the garlic powder, salt, and pepper until the cheese is melted and the sauce is smooth.
- Step 4: Assemble the Casserole. Gently stir the uncooked rice and the bite-sized chicken pieces into the creamy cheese sauce.
- Step 5: Bake the Casserole. Pour the entire mixture into a 9×13 inch baking dish and spread it into an even layer. Cover the baking dish tightly with aluminum foil and bake for 40 minutes.
- Step 6: The Cheesy Finish. After 40 minutes, carefully remove the foil. Sprinkle the remaining ½ cup of shredded cheese evenly over the top of the casserole. Return the dish to the oven, uncovered, and bake for another 10-15 minutes, until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Step 7: Rest and Serve. Let the casserole rest for at least 10 minutes before serving. This important step allows the sauce to set up and makes serving much easier.
Storage Options
This hearty chicken and rice casserole makes for fantastic leftovers for a quick and easy lunch the next day. Once the casserole has cooled completely, you can either cover the baking dish tightly with foil or transfer individual portions to an airtight container. It will stay fresh in the refrigerator for up to 4 days and can be easily reheated in the microwave.
Variations and Substitutions
This classic comfort food casserole is a wonderful and versatile template that you can easily adapt. To add some extra vegetables, you can stir in about a cup of frozen peas or some steamed broccoli florets along with the chicken and rice. For a different flavour profile, you can use a can of condensed cheddar cheese soup as a shortcut for the sauce, or experiment with different cheeses like a Monterey Jack or a Swiss cheese. For a crunchy topping, you can sprinkle some crushed buttery crackers or French’s fried onions over the cheese during the last 5 minutes of baking.
Practical & Valuable Tips
For the most flavourful casserole, be sure to take the extra minute to brown your chicken pieces before you add them to the sauce. To ensure your rice cooks perfectly, it is very important to cover the dish tightly with aluminum foil for the first part of the baking process to trap all the steam. Finally, letting the finished casserole rest on the counter for a full 10 minutes before you slice into it is a crucial step that helps the dish to set up properly for beautiful, clean slices.
Frequently Asked Questions
- My rice was still crunchy after baking. What did I do wrong? Crunchy rice is almost always because the casserole was either not covered tightly enough with foil, or it simply needed more liquid or a longer cooking time. Ensure you have a very tight seal with your foil to trap the steam, and if your rice is still hard after the initial bake, you can add a splash more broth, cover it, and bake for another 15 minutes.
- Can I use brown rice in this recipe instead of white rice? You can, but you will need to make significant adjustments. Brown rice takes much longer to cook and absorbs more liquid than white rice. You would need to increase the amount of broth in the recipe by at least a cup and increase the initial covered baking time to at least 60-70 minutes.
- Can I use leftover cooked rice instead of uncooked? Yes, you can adapt this recipe for cooked rice. You would simply prepare the sauce and the chicken as directed, and then stir in about 4 cups of cooked rice. You would then only need to bake the casserole for about 20-25 minutes, just until it is hot and bubbly.
- Can I assemble this casserole a day ahead and bake it later? It is not recommended to assemble this dish with uncooked rice too far in advance. The rice will start to absorb the cold liquid as it sits in the fridge, which can affect the final texture. However, you can save time by chopping your onion and chicken ahead of time.
- What vegetables are good to add to this chicken and rice casserole? This casserole is a perfect place to add extra vegetables! Sautéed sliced mushrooms are a classic addition that you can cook with the onion. You can also easily stir in a cup of frozen mixed vegetables, like peas and carrots, along with the rice and chicken before you bake it.
